如何使用ACTION_DEVICE_STORAGE_LOW来避免OutOfMemoryError?

时间:2011-03-14 11:28:51

标签: android memory-management bitmap broadcastreceiver

我在一篇关于OutOfMemoryError的帖子中发现(主要是由于BITMAP),当Heap要满时,可以通过Broadcastreceiver(ACTION_DEVICE_STORAGE_LOW)通知它。任何人都可以告诉如何实现这个广播接收器并避免OutOfMemoryError吗?

2 个答案:

答案 0 :(得分:3)

ACTION_DEVICE_STORAGE_LOW通知您手机永久存储空间不足。它与应用程序堆上的空间无关,因此您无法将其用于此目的。

答案 1 :(得分:1)

给出了答案 你给的另一篇文章 Android OutOfMemoryException